2025 Volvo EX90 Twin Motor Performance MPGe
EPA-rated · verified snapshot 2026-08-30 · Standard Sport Utility Vehicle 4WD
The 2025 Volvo EX90 Twin Motor Performance gets 84 MPGe combined — 86 city and 82 highway — in its most efficient configuration (Automatic (A1) · All-Wheel Drive · EV).

FAQ
Where does the 2025 EX90 Twin Motor Performance rank among suvs for MPG?
The 2025 EX90 Twin Motor Performance's 84 MPGe combined is above the suvs average of 40.3 MPGe for 2025.
How much does it cost to fuel a 2025 EX90 Twin Motor Performance per year?
Based on EPA assumptions (15,000 miles/year), estimated annual fuel cost is $900 for the most efficient trim.
What is the city and highway MPG of the 2025 EX90 Twin Motor Performance?
The most efficient trim is rated 86 MPGe city and 82 MPGe highway.
